The American Juggernaut François Pascal Simon (1770-1837) View with two figures beneath'The American Juggernaut', 1864. This cartoon depicts the horror of war. The old definition of 'juggernaut' is a huge, unstoppable object. Here, that object is the contemporary machinery of warfare, driven on its way by the spirits of Death and crushing anything and anyone in its path.
